Hi Raj,
You need to perform the post-installation activities to see the content in Software Catalog in SLD. Refer to section "Updating the CR Data in SLD" in the XI Post-Installation Guide.
SLD contains software and system catalog.
Software catalog describes installed products and SWCs.
Systems catalog describes the systems in your data center
with 1) physical view(Technical) and 2)logical view(Business System).
Info from Software Catalog is used in Design time of your scenarios.
Info from System Catalog is used in defining the routing rules.
SWC is primary container for all your design objects
You should have content for all of SAP Products and SWC by updating the CR Content.
For all the products other than SAP you have to create Products and SWCs. As I mentioned earlier, these are primary containers or place holders for all your design objects.

Product SCM 5.0 in Central SLD Software Catalog
Hi,
I've an installation of NW 2004s, SCM 5.0 and a Solution Manager that is doing of central SLD. I have perform the post installations steps for SCM but I'm not seeing the product SCM 5.0 in the Software Catalog when selecting Software Type "Product" on the central SLD, I just see SCM 4.1.
When selecting Software Type "Software Components" in the Software Catalog screen, there is a software component SAP SCM that has version SAP SCM 5.0.
Why it doesn't show the product for SAP SCM 5.0?
Many thanks.
Rodrigo.You have to update your CIM file on the Server
SLD content has been updated from time to time.
You can download the most up-to-date files from the SAP Service Marketplace. See SAP Note
669669 for details information.
Procedure for importing the data is
1. Choose Content --> Import. The browser displays the Import Selection screen.
2. Next to the Import File field, choose Browse.
3. To import the component information data, navigate to the following file:
<server>\usr\sap\<SAPSID>\SYS\global\sld\model\cr_content.zip (Microsoft
Windows) and then choose Open.
Objects that already exist in the system are automatically overwritten.
4. If you do not want to import the instances into the current namespace, you can change the namespace.
5. Choose Import.

How to Create Software components , Technical systems , Business Systems
Hi,
How to Create Software components , Technical systems , Business Systems and Logical Systems
and Link between them. foe different adapters.
Ponts will be awarded..
Regards,
Jayasimha Jangam.Steps to create software component,
1. Goto SLD --> Software catalog
2.select new product
3.Fill the Vendor, Name , version and choose create
4.now go back to the SLD main page and then choose software type as sofware component
5. select new component and in the next page select your product which you have created in the previous step
6.then give your vendor, name and version and choose create
7. now the sofware component is created, you can import the same in you integration repository for your scenario
